Definition

UNFIX: to remove or detach something that has been fixed in place, or to free oneself from a set mindset or established belief.

Unfix sentence examples

  1. The engineer had to unfix the component to make the necessary adjustments.
  2. After years of adhering to tradition, she decided to unfix her perspective on success.
  3. He managed to unfix the stubborn lid from the jar after several attempts.
  4. The team worked together to unfix the schedule that had become too rigid and unmanageable.
  5. In therapy, they encouraged him to unfix his negative thought patterns and embrace a new mindset.
